About this episode
The episode explores the popularity of The Solitary Gourmet and its significance for Japanese listening practice.
Send us Fan Mail We try to explain why The Solitary Gourmet, a plotless Japanese food drama about a man eating alone, became a massive hit across East Asia. We also dig into why it’s one of the best resources for real Japanese listening practice and what “healing” media reveals about modern comfort viewing. • the show’s simple formula and why “nothing happens” works • how real restaurants turn episodes into a food culture guide • why the inner monologue is gold for Japanese...
